If you are based in Singapore, consider using a time-tested forex trading website to enter the market effectively. Here are the basic steps to create an account on a forex trading website there:  

1. Choose the Right Forex Broker:

Singapore is teeming with forex brokers so much that you will be spoilt for choice when it comes to choosing one from them. This implies that you cannot choose a dealer randomly but have to conduct thorough research to come up with one having a good standing in the market so that you can get help from him thoroughly in forex trading from start to finish. Simply put, the dealer should offer the right trading platform, tools, and services that can effectively cater to your trading needs. Also, be focused on hiring a dealer considering that his trading regulation, fees, and the diversity of currency pairs, including other assets available for trading, are viable.

2. Create a Demo Account:

As we know, the well-known proverb “practice makes a man perfect’, with this in mind, the best way to become a professional forex broker in Singapore is by practicing it regularly. Getting around the practice is most likely to invalidate your official trading account or make it inoperable eventually. Thankfully, you can start practicing to the fullest in Singapore by creating a demo account on a reputable trading website. This is because many Singapore-based trading platforms generally provide their trading learners with a gratis demo account.

3. Carry out the Application Process:

After you have found the best forex broker in Singapore, it is time to carry out the application process on its website to create a trading account. In general, you will find an online application form to be filled out by furnishing all information required, for example, your ID and address proof. 

4. Furnish Money for your Account:

After the online trading platform has okayed your forex trading account, you are almost ready to get your forex trading off the ground by funding it by using your debit/credit card or any other payment method the platform supports.
